Stat. § 24-723.01","body":"Upon order of the Supreme Court, a Justice or judge of the Supreme Court or other judge shall be disqualified from acting as a Justice or judge of the Supreme Court or other judge, without loss of salary, while there is pending (1) an indictment or information charging him or her in the United States with a crime punishable as a felony under Nebraska or federal law or (2) a recommendation to the Supreme Court by the Commission on Judicial Qualifications for his or her removal or retirement.","path":["NE Code","Chapter 24"],"source_url":"https://nebraskalegislature.gov/laws/statutes.php?statute=24-723.01","current_through":"2026-08-14","vintage":"open-us-law v2026.08, retrieved 2026-09-14","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T18:32:21Z","sha256":"06accd9a942d4a0d398b996a914026360a7bc192db7286b8b24dec6f1917d38a","source_id":"us-ne","stale":false,"prev":"us-ne/neb.-rev.-stat.-24-723","next":"us-ne/neb.-rev.-stat.-24-723.02"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
